Evolution of Mesh Fixation for Hernia Repair

Abstract:

Hernia repair remains one of the most common surgical procedures performed around the world. Over the past several decades, in response to various mesh-related complications and coinciding with the influx of laparoscopy into the field of general surgery, numerous advancements have been made in regards to the technology of mesh products being used in hernia repair today. Along these same lines, devices used for mesh fixation have evolved at a similar pace. The goal of this chapter is to review the various different materials and methods of mesh fixation being utilized in both ventral and inguinal hernia repair today.
